织梦CMS - 轻松建站从此开始!

我的网站

当前位置: 主页 > 竞争币 > 以太坊

社交恢复钱包+Rollup 是更好的钱包方案(4)

时间:2021-01-11 16:38来源:未知 作者:admin 点击:
这项技术最初是在比特币生态系统中开发的,但优秀的多重签名钱包(例如 Gnosis Safe)现在也适用于以太坊。多重签名钱包在组织内部是非常成功的:以太

Vitalik Buterin:社交恢复钱包+Rollup 是更好的钱包方案

这项技术最初是在比特币生态系统中开发的,但优秀的多重签名钱包(例如 Gnosis Safe)现在也适用于以太坊。多重签名钱包在组织内部是非常成功的:以太坊基金会使用了一个 4-of-7 多重签名钱包来存储资金,以太坊生态系统中的许多其他组织也是如此。

而对于个人来说,使用多重签名钱包的主要挑战是:谁持有资金,以及如何批准交易?最常见的公式是「两个易于访问但独立的密钥是由你掌握的(笔记本或手机),第三个是更安全但易访问的备份,其离线存放或由朋友或机构托管。」

这是相当安全的:即便其中一个设备丢失或被盗,你也可以访问到自己的资金。但安全性远不是完美的:如果你能偷别人的笔记本电脑,偷他们的手机通常也没有那么难。可用性也是一个挑战,因为现在每笔交易都需要使用两个设备进行两次确认。

社交恢复是更好的选择

这让我想到了我最喜欢的钱包保护方法:社交恢复。社交恢复系统的工作原理如下:

  1. 只有一个「签名密钥」可用于批准交易;
  2. 有一组(至少 3 个或更多)的「守护人」,其中多数人就可合作更改帐户的签名密钥。

签名密钥可以添加或删除守护人,但会有一个延迟期(通常是 1-3 天)。

Vitalik Buterin:社交恢复钱包+Rollup 是更好的钱包方案

在所有正常情况下,用户只需像普通钱包一样使用他们的社交恢复钱包,使用他们的签名密钥对消息进行签名,这样每笔签名的交易都可以通过一次确认点击完成,就像在「传统」的钱包那样(例如 Metamask)。

如果用户丢失了他们的签名密钥,那么社交恢复功能就会启动。用户只需联系他们的守护人,让他们签署一项特殊交易,将钱包合约中注册的签名公钥更改为新的。这很简单:他们可以简单地去访问一个页面,例如 security.loopring.io,登录,查看恢复请求并签名。对于每一个守护人来说,操作就像进行一笔 Uniswap 交易一样容易。

对于选谁作为守护人,有很多种可能的选择。最常见的三种选择是:

  1. 钱包持有者自己拥有的其他设备(或纸质助记词);
  2. 朋友和家人;
  3. 机构,如果他们得到了你的电话号码或电子邮件的确认,或者在价值很高的情况下,通过视频电话亲自核实你的身份,机构就会签署一条恢复信息;

守护人是很容易添加的:你只需要输入他们的 ENS 域名或 ETH 地址即可添加守护人,不过大多数社交恢复钱包都要求守护人在恢复网页中签署交易,以同意添加守护人。在任何设计合理的社交恢复钱包中,守护人不需要下载和使用同一个钱包。他们只需使用现有的以太坊钱包,无论是哪种类型的钱包。考虑到添加守护人的高度便利性,如果你足够幸运,你的社交圈已经由以太坊用户组成,我个人倾向于增加守护人的数量(最好是 7 个以上),以提高安全性。如果你已经有了一个钱包,那么你就不需要一直在精神上努力做一个守护人:你所做的任何恢复操作都会通过你现有的钱包来完成。如果你不认识许多其他活跃的以太坊用户,那么你信任的技术上有能力的少数守护人则是最好的。 (责任编辑:admin)

织梦二维码生成器
顶一下
(0)
0%
踩一下
(0)
0%
------分隔线----------------------------
发表评论
请自觉遵守互联网相关的政策法规,严禁发布色情、暴力、反动的言论。
评价:
表情:
用户名: 验证码:点击我更换图片
栏目列表
推荐内容